List Of Awards And Nominations Received By Red Hot Chili Peppers

Red Hot Chili Peppers is an alternative rock band formed in 1983 in Los Angeles, California. Red Hot Chili Peppers have received a total of sixteen awards and 65 nominations world-wide throughout their career. These include a total seven Grammy Award wins out of sixteen nominations. 2006's Stadium Arcadium was the band's first album nominated for the Album of the Year Grammy award. Red Hot Chili Peppers have also received 27 nominations for MTV Music Video Awards, including Video of the Year, for the song "Under the Bridge" and in 2000, the Video Vanguard Award.

Red Hot Chili Peppers and many of their works have had great critical acclaim. Their albums, Californation and Blood Sugar Sex Magik, have both ranked in Rolling Stone's 500 Greatest Albums of All Time, placing at 310 and 399, respectively. In 2008, Red Hot Chili Peppers was awarded with a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ame.

On April 14, 2012 the band was inducted by Chris Rock into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ame. Members inducted were Flea, Chad Smith, John Frusciante, Jack Irons, Anthony Kiedis, Josh Klinghoffer, Cliff Martinez and Hillel Slovak. Klinghoffer became the youngest inductee ever passing Stevie Wonder.
